Charles Fitzhugh Talman

3 books

Charles Fitzhugh Talman was an American author known for his contributions to the fields of meteorology and education. His notable work, "Meteorology: The Science of the Atmosphere," explores the principles and phenomena of weather, making complex scientific concepts accessible to a broader audience. Talman also contributed to the educational series "The Mentor," where he wrote about various topics, including coal and weather, aimed at enhancing public understanding of these subjects. His writings reflect a commitment to disseminating knowledge and fostering interest in science during the early 20th century.
